(MENAFN) Bangladesh foreign ministry stated that a new accord was signed with Qatar for the importing of four million tons of Liquefied Natural Gas (LNG)to meet the local demand in Bangladesh, reported Gulf Times.
The agreement was signed by the Qatari Minister of State for Energy & Industry Affairs, HE Dr Mohamed bin Saleh al-Sada, and Mohamed Mosbah Eldeen, Bangladesh�s secretary of energy.
Dr. Al-Sada said this deal has the cost of $1 to $1.5 billion on an annual basis. The current number for gas demand in Bangladesh currently stands at 2,500 million cubic foot per day.
